|
@@ -1,5 +1,6 @@
|
|
|
package ${packageName}.service.impl;
|
|
package ${packageName}.service.impl;
|
|
|
|
|
|
|
|
|
|
+import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
|
|
|
import java.util.List;
|
|
import java.util.List;
|
|
|
#foreach ($column in $columns)
|
|
#foreach ($column in $columns)
|
|
|
#if($column.javaField == 'createTime' || $column.javaField == 'updateTime')
|
|
#if($column.javaField == 'createTime' || $column.javaField == 'updateTime')
|
|
@@ -21,19 +22,19 @@ import ${packageName}.service.I${ClassName}Service;
|
|
|
|
|
|
|
|
/**
|
|
/**
|
|
|
* ${functionName}Service业务层处理
|
|
* ${functionName}Service业务层处理
|
|
|
- *
|
|
|
|
|
|
|
+ *
|
|
|
* @author ${author}
|
|
* @author ${author}
|
|
|
* @date ${datetime}
|
|
* @date ${datetime}
|
|
|
*/
|
|
*/
|
|
|
@Service
|
|
@Service
|
|
|
-public class ${ClassName}ServiceImpl implements I${ClassName}Service
|
|
|
|
|
|
|
+public class ${ClassName}ServiceImpl extends ServiceImpl<${ClassName}Mapper, ${ClassName}> implements I${ClassName}Service
|
|
|
{
|
|
{
|
|
|
@Autowired
|
|
@Autowired
|
|
|
private ${ClassName}Mapper ${className}Mapper;
|
|
private ${ClassName}Mapper ${className}Mapper;
|
|
|
|
|
|
|
|
/**
|
|
/**
|
|
|
* 查询${functionName}
|
|
* 查询${functionName}
|
|
|
- *
|
|
|
|
|
|
|
+ *
|
|
|
* @param ${pkColumn.javaField} ${functionName}主键
|
|
* @param ${pkColumn.javaField} ${functionName}主键
|
|
|
* @return ${functionName}
|
|
* @return ${functionName}
|
|
|
*/
|
|
*/
|
|
@@ -45,7 +46,7 @@ public class ${ClassName}ServiceImpl implements I${ClassName}Service
|
|
|
|
|
|
|
|
/**
|
|
/**
|
|
|
* 查询${functionName}列表
|
|
* 查询${functionName}列表
|
|
|
- *
|
|
|
|
|
|
|
+ *
|
|
|
* @param ${className} ${functionName}
|
|
* @param ${className} ${functionName}
|
|
|
* @return ${functionName}
|
|
* @return ${functionName}
|
|
|
*/
|
|
*/
|
|
@@ -57,7 +58,7 @@ public class ${ClassName}ServiceImpl implements I${ClassName}Service
|
|
|
|
|
|
|
|
/**
|
|
/**
|
|
|
* 新增${functionName}
|
|
* 新增${functionName}
|
|
|
- *
|
|
|
|
|
|
|
+ *
|
|
|
* @param ${className} ${functionName}
|
|
* @param ${className} ${functionName}
|
|
|
* @return 结果
|
|
* @return 结果
|
|
|
*/
|
|
*/
|
|
@@ -83,7 +84,7 @@ public class ${ClassName}ServiceImpl implements I${ClassName}Service
|
|
|
|
|
|
|
|
/**
|
|
/**
|
|
|
* 修改${functionName}
|
|
* 修改${functionName}
|
|
|
- *
|
|
|
|
|
|
|
+ *
|
|
|
* @param ${className} ${functionName}
|
|
* @param ${className} ${functionName}
|
|
|
* @return 结果
|
|
* @return 结果
|
|
|
*/
|
|
*/
|
|
@@ -107,7 +108,7 @@ public class ${ClassName}ServiceImpl implements I${ClassName}Service
|
|
|
|
|
|
|
|
/**
|
|
/**
|
|
|
* 批量删除${functionName}
|
|
* 批量删除${functionName}
|
|
|
- *
|
|
|
|
|
|
|
+ *
|
|
|
* @param ${pkColumn.javaField}s 需要删除的${functionName}主键
|
|
* @param ${pkColumn.javaField}s 需要删除的${functionName}主键
|
|
|
* @return 结果
|
|
* @return 结果
|
|
|
*/
|
|
*/
|
|
@@ -125,7 +126,7 @@ public class ${ClassName}ServiceImpl implements I${ClassName}Service
|
|
|
|
|
|
|
|
/**
|
|
/**
|
|
|
* 删除${functionName}信息
|
|
* 删除${functionName}信息
|
|
|
- *
|
|
|
|
|
|
|
+ *
|
|
|
* @param ${pkColumn.javaField} ${functionName}主键
|
|
* @param ${pkColumn.javaField} ${functionName}主键
|
|
|
* @return 结果
|
|
* @return 结果
|
|
|
*/
|
|
*/
|
|
@@ -144,7 +145,7 @@ public class ${ClassName}ServiceImpl implements I${ClassName}Service
|
|
|
|
|
|
|
|
/**
|
|
/**
|
|
|
* 新增${subTable.functionName}信息
|
|
* 新增${subTable.functionName}信息
|
|
|
- *
|
|
|
|
|
|
|
+ *
|
|
|
* @param ${className} ${functionName}对象
|
|
* @param ${className} ${functionName}对象
|
|
|
*/
|
|
*/
|
|
|
public void insert${subClassName}(${ClassName} ${className})
|
|
public void insert${subClassName}(${ClassName} ${className})
|